Centurion is proud to be the provider of comprehensive healthcare services to the Florida Department of Corrections.

We are currently seeking a full-time Mental Health Professional to join our team at Charlotte Correctional Institution located in Punta Gorda, Florida.

The Mental Health Professional provides mental health case management services to patients in a correctional setting and consults with a multi-disciplinary team in providing comprehensive mental health care, including : intake and assessments, crisis intervention, treatment planning, and providing individual and group therapy.

8am-4 : 30pm; Monday - Friday

Salary : $80K to $85K for fully licensed or $70K to $75K

Qualifications

  • Masters level degree in Psychology, Social Work, Counseling, or related field from an accredited educational institution required.
  • Active mental health professional license in Florida - LMHC, LCSW, LMFT, MH or SW interns
  • Must have active Basic Life Support certification.
  • Minimum of two years’ experience with direct care for individuals with mental illness preferred.
  • Must be able to pass a background investigation and obtain agency security clearance where applicable.
